/* | |||
* Convert a user's 2D image into a texture image. This basically repacks | |||
* pixel data into the special texture formats used by core Mesa and the DRI | |||
* drivers. This function can do full images or subimages. | |||
* | |||
* We return a boolean because this function may not accept some kinds of | |||
* source image formats and/or types. For example, if the incoming | |||
* format/type = GL_BGR, GL_UNSIGNED_INT this function probably won't | |||
* be able to do the conversion. | |||
* | |||
* In that case, the incoming image should first be simplified to one of | |||
* the "canonical" formats (GL_ALPHA, GL_LUMINANCE, GL_LUMINANCE_ALPHA, | |||
* GL_INTENSITY, GL_RGB, GL_RGBA) and types (GL_CHAN). We can do that | |||
* with the _mesa_transfer_teximage() function. That function will also | |||
* do image transfer operations such as scale/bias and convolution. | |||
* | |||
* Input: | |||
* mesaFormat - one of the MESA_FORMAT_* values from texformat.h | |||
* xoffset, yoffset - position in dest image to put data | |||
* width, height - incoming image size, also size of dest region. | |||
* dstImageWidth - width (row stride) of dest image in pixels | |||
* format, type - incoming image format and type | |||
* packing - describes incoming image packing | |||
* srcImage - pointer to source image | |||
* destImage - pointer to dest image | |||
*/ | |||
